Apple Streamlines iPhone Lineup, Prioritizing AI Compatibility
Apple has made a significant shift in its iPhone strategy, discontinuing several older models to eliminate fragmentation caused by its new Apple Intelligence features. This move ensures that any iPhone you purchase directly from Apple will be fully equipped to take advantage of the company’s growing suite of AI tools. The Apple Intelligence “Problem” & Its Solution
Initially, the rollout of Apple Intelligence with iOS 18 created a divide. Not all iPhones could support the advanced AI capabilities. Specifically, the iPhone 15 and older models were left out. This created a perhaps confusing situation for consumers, and apple has proactively addressed it.
Now, Apple is committed to selling only iPhones compatible with Apple Intelligence. This simplifies the buying process and guarantees a consistent experience for all new iPhone users. Which iPhones Were Discontinued?
the changes unfolded in stages throughout 2024 and into 2025. Here’s a timeline of the models removed from Apple’s official sales channels:
* Initial iOS 18 Declaration (June 2024): Apple Intelligence was initially limited to the iPhone 15 Pro and iPhone 15 Pro Max. The standard iPhone 15 and 15 Plus,along with all iPhone 14 models,were ineligible.
* Fall 2024 iPhone Lineup: Despite the launch of the iPhone 16 series, some older models – including select iPhone SE 3, iPhone 14, and iPhone 15 versions – remained in stock but were not Apple Intelligence compatible.
* Early 2025: Apple removed the iPhone SE 3, iPhone 14, and iPhone 14 Plus from its lineup with the introduction of the more affordable iPhone 16e.
* Recent update: The iPhone 15 and iPhone 15 Plus were the final models removed, leaving only Apple Intelligence-compatible devices available.
It’s crucial to note that while Apple has discontinued these models directly, you may still find limited stock at electronics retailers or thru mobile carriers.
Your Current iPhone Options
Currently, Apple’s official iPhone lineup consists entirely of devices that support Apple Intelligence. These include:
* iPhone 16e
* iPhone 16
* iPhone 16 Plus
* iPhone 17
* iPhone Air
* iPhone 17 Pro
* iPhone 17 Pro Max
This streamlined approach ensures you’ll have access to the latest AI features from the moment you set up your new device.
